Rice-Noodle Shop Explosion in Pai Kills One, Injures Two

A residential rice-noodle shop in Pai district, Mae Hong Son province, exploded late on the morning of 6 December 2025, killing one woman and injuring two men. The blast occurred at around 10:30 behind Wat Najlong, where a pressure cooker used in the production process reportedly malfunctioned and detonated. Police, investigators and patrol units rushed to the scene to secure the area and assess the extent of the damage.

 

Officers arriving at house number 289, Moo 6, Mae Na Toeng subdistrict, found the shop interior destroyed by the force of the explosion. The deceased was identified as Ms Kingkaew Chanduon, 52, the shop owner who lived at the same address. Two injured men were also found: Mr Chamnong Thamson, her brother and Mr Worawit Kitam, her husband, both of whom were transported urgently to hospital.

 

According to witness Mr Wisut Phanwa, four people were inside the shop at the time, all helping with rice-noodle production. He stated that the electric pressure cooker suddenly exploded without warning, causing fatal injuries to Ms Kingkaew and harming the others nearby. Police said this preliminary account would form part of the formal investigation and would be cross-checked with technical evidence.

 

Investigators from Pai Police Station, including prevention officers and motorcycle patrols, worked alongside inquiry officers to document the scene. Authorities noted the structural damage indicated a high-pressure failure within the equipment. Officials have notified the regional forensics unit, which is expected to conduct a detailed inspection of the cooker and related electrical systems.

 

SiamRath reported that police confirmed they are preparing a full report for senior commanders as efforts continue to determine why the pressure system malfunctioned. Additional statements will be taken from witnesses and family members once their conditions stabilise. Further updates are expected once forensic specialists complete their examination and confirm the exact cause of the explosion.
